SPCC Programs and Services
Intervention Program (IP)
▪ Psycho-social help and support to the exploited and abused Children and Women through:
< Home Visitation
< Referral Services
< Counseling Sessions
< Rescue Operation
< Para-Legal Assistance
< Educational Assistance
Prevention and Community Education(PCE)
▪ Advocacy and awareness raising through Symposium, Forums, Conferences and Lobby Sessions
Formation and Trainings of Child Rights Advocates (FTCRA)
▪ Capability- building of Child Rights Advocates (CRAs) as partners in protecting and upholding the Rights of the Child.
Community Organizing (CO)
▪ A vital tool for the social transformation of the community
Networking and Linkages (NL)
▪ A venue for broader connections and coordination with other child- caring agencies and communities
Special Programs:
Read-Aloud Program
▪ An alternative activity for children which aims to enhance their interest and joy in reading.
Livelihood Program
▪ An income generating activity for mothers to help augment their Family income.
Feeding Program
▪ A supplemental feeding activity for clinically underweight children in the Parish.
